Aerospace Engineering - BEng Hons

Course Details

Objectives: This course introduces you to all core aerospace concepts such as propulsion and aerodynamics before you move on to advanced and specialist material.

Intended for: Students

Admission requirements: A levels: AAA-AAB including A in maths and preferably physics. A level general studies and critical thinking not accepted as part of the grade offer. Maths is essential.

IB: 36-34; 6 in maths at Higher Level or 7 at Standard Level, plus preferably 5 in physics at Higher Level or 6 at Standard Level.

Duration and terms: 3 years full-time
